Battery Chemistry Types

I explore different battery chemistries such as lead-acid (AGM, GEL, flooded) and lithium-ion. Each type has pros and cons regarding lifespan, weight, maintenance, and cost. For example, lithium batteries are lighter and last longer but are more expensive, while lead-acid batteries are heavier and require more upkeep.

Charging Requirements and Efficiency

Different batteries have specific charging voltage and current needs. I verify that my charger or solar controller is compatible with the 12V 200Ah battery to maintain its health and efficiency. Efficient batteries also help reduce energy loss.

Maintenance Needs

I consider how much upkeep the battery requires. Flooded lead-acid batteries need regular water refills, while AGM and lithium batteries are generally maintenance-free. My choice depends on how much time and effort I want to invest in battery care.
